In 1906, Harvey Martin entered the world in Missouri, born to George Martin and Jennie Atwood. In 1910, Harvey Martin resided in Bonhomme, Saint Louis, Missouri, USA. In 1920, Harvey Martin resided in Joachim, Jefferson, Missouri, USA. Harvey Martin married Glenda Bible. Harvey Martin passed away in 1940 in Jefferson, Missouri, USA.
